Before you give gold for the day there is a list of who gave you gold last. Once you have gifted 3, the list disappears. It's in your Newsfeed.

For me, neighbours are about maps and Sparkles. I still get a kick out of it when my habitats have sparkles.
I have a lot of great neighbours who visit regularly. And I check my islands multiple times a day to collect.

As you progress further in the game you will require more and more maps. I'm at level 91 and I need 64 maps to expand one plot. So it takes me almost a week from start to finish.
Yes you can only get 20 maps a day. Or 20 lotus blossoms. Or a combination of both that adds up to 20.

Whoa, wait a second.....are some of you guys saying that there are dragons that produce/give you gold??? I've never heard this before! Could someone please explain / list the dragons that do this? Thanks!

cocauina
07-11-14, 11:08 AM
Whoa, wait a second.....are some of you guys saying that there are dragons that produce/give you gold??? I've never heard this before! Could someone please explain / list the dragons that do this? Thanks!

Goldwing, Treasure, Gilded, Stainglass and Midas are the dragons who give gold, you can only have 1 dragon from each, that means you can have 5 different gold dragons.

The dragons aren't breedable, you need to buy them in the market or in value packs if TL makes values pack with gold dragons.
From this 5 dragons, 2 of them are expired, Stainglass and Midas, they only appears whenever TL decides to put them again in the game for a limited time.

The habitat for them is "Treasure Terrace", only holds 2 dragons and 5 gold, it's the most expensive habtitat, the build time is none.

The cost of each dragon, is:
Goldwing - 1,800 gold
Treasure - 2,000 gold
Gilded - 2,000 gold (bought him for 300 when he was released)
Stainglass and Midas - 800 gold

Every gold dragon give, per day, 1 gold in baby form, 2 in juvenile form, 4 in adult form and 5 in epic form.

There's the most important info, hope it helps :)

I don't know if you know that and if you are gonna understand what I will say, but it's a important info too, when you have a gold dragon in the habitat, I advice you to have an exactly hour to collect the gold, collect 24h and a couple minutes later every day or not, that deppends what level is your gold dragon, if you have 1 or 2 dragons in the same habitat and how active are you in the game, for example, when the dragon is between lvl 1 to 3 you can wait 5 days to collect 5 gold instead of collecting every day only 1 gold xD if it's between lvl 4 to 6 you can wait 2 and a half days to collect 5 gold, if it's between lvl 7 to 9 you can wait 1 day and 6 hours to collect 5 gold, and when the dragon is on lvl 10 you only need to wait a whole day, hope I could help again xD

This happens too with all the habitats, but the gold one is more important, in my opinion ahah
